Entropy means disorder, sometimes the second law of thermodynamics is known as the law of entropy. Potential energy is the energy stored, an example is moving something against gravity. Kinetic energy is the movement of energy, an example is pushing a swing: define first law efficiency. Explain in real-world terms and give an example of how we can conserve energy by improving first law efficiency. The first law efficiency is the ratio of energy delivered, to the amount of energy supplied to meet a particular need. An example would be using a device that would use less energy, a high efficiency furnace, more efficient engine to power a car, does the same thing with less energy: define second law efficiency.
